Linens valued at 30,000. Master: Bernot Johanlange Date of Loss: R
The Admiralty Court Case Papers record the stranding of the LIEFDE of Hamburg near Dover. Many parcels of the cargo were salvaged. These included holland checked linen, brandy, pipe staves and coarse linen. The status of the vessel is not recorded.(2)
